One of AEW's most popular names, Adam Cole, shared a heartbreaking update regarding his wrestling career last weekend at All In : Texas. Now, the former multi-time champion's stable-mates, Kyle O'Reilly and Roderick Strong, have delivered their mission statement as they consider moving forward without their long-time ally.
Last Saturday at All In 2025, Adam Cole was supposed to defend his TNT Title against Kyle Fletcher. However, it was revealed ahead of the pay-per-view that The Panama City Playboy had not been cleared for competition, and would thus relinquish his belt, which would be up for grabs in a fatal four-way match at the Globe Life Field. Cole made an appearance at the stadium show itself, and despite voicing uncertainty regarding his wrestling future, effusively thanked fans for their constant support.
Present alongside the former NXT Champion in Texas had been his long-time teammates, Kyle O'Reilly and Roderick Strong, who looked visibly overwhelmed over their ally's announcement. Now, AEW's official X/Twitter profile has shared a backstage exclusive featuring The Violent Artist and The Messiah of the Backbreaker. The latter lamented Adam Cole getting sidelined after finally reuniting their old band alongside O'Reilly.
Kyle then reflected on the importance of making the best of the time one has on their hands, and voiced his resolve to not be stuck in limbo because his long-time teammate is dealing with health issues. With Strong's assurance that they were on the same page, O'Reilly vowed that The Paragon would continue to pursue their goals, and stated that everything that they do from this point on would be for Adam Cole.
Who did the TNT Title go to at AEW All In
Later on at All In : Texas, the TNT Championship was contested over between Kyle Fletcher, Daniel Garcia, Sammy Guevara and Dustin Rhodes. Although most viewers were expecting The Protostar to win the belt, it was The Natural who pulled off the shocking upset, obtaining his first singles title in AEW in the process.
It remains to be seen how long Rhodes' reign as TNT Champion will last. Currently the veteran also holds the ROH World Tag and World Six-Man Tag Team belts in Ring of Honor.
